Budgets

Scott Cromar

Chapter Chapter 8 in From Techie to Boss, 2013, pp 127-134 from Springer

Abstract: Abstract Nobody likes writing up budgets. It is a lot less fun than learning a new technology or architecting a new service. But the organization you work for needs to bring in more money than it sends out, or it is in trouble.
